]> git.xonotic.org Git - xonotic/xonotic.wiki.git/blob - Proposal_for_Board_of_Leaders_elections_draft.textile
1st draft
[xonotic/xonotic.wiki.git] / Proposal_for_Board_of_Leaders_elections_draft.textile
1 h1. Proposal for Board of Leaders elections draft
2
3 Board of Leaders consists of 6 members, who responsible for fostering and foreseeing growth of Xonotic. Leaders should listen to community wishes and set the project goals in accordance what they think is the best way to the project. They also accept or reject content into the main Xonotic repository, which are they responsible for (be it code, art, maps, models, music, documentation) and strive to make Xonotic unified, unique and attractive. They also seek ways to get public attention and funds for development. They also responsible for proper working of Xonotic web site, code repository and other materials. Each leader is responsible for working with his specialty developers and explaining the goals that should be done and how to achieve that (e.g. modeling leaders has a list of all volunteering modelers and helps them understanding how to other parts of the game relate to models and what could be done). Therefore, I propose that there would be 6 leaders which should take positions of:
4
5 * Leader Coder
6 * Leader Modeler and art designer
7 * Leader Music and sounds designer
8 * Leader Community manager
9 * Leader Web architect
10 * Leader Mapper
11
12 Major gameplay or whole Xonotic project related decisions should be made only by ALL LEADERS CONSENSUS (basically, that means anyone from the leaders has a VETO vote).
13
14 h2. What is each leader responsible for:
15
16 * Leader Coder:
17   creating coding goals, for all coding related issues and organizing other code developers
18
19 * Leader Modeler and art designer:
20   creating modelling goals, for all modeling related issues and organizing other modeling developers, creating and maintaining of common Xonotic models repository
21
22 * Leader Music and sounds designer
23   creating  goals, for all modeling related issues and organizing other modeling developers, creating and maintaining of common Xonotic models repository
24
25 * Leader Community manager
26   community development groups, public relationship, mass media, clan activities, tournaments, informing other leaders what players community needs or wants
27
28 * Leader Web architect
29   maintaining Xonotic web site and integrating related web projects, both with Leader Community manager working on common projects
30
31 * Leader Mapper
32   maintaining texture repository in a working state, responsible that only quality maps reach base or main Xonotic maps repository
33
34 h2. Groups appointed by the leaders:
35
36 Quality Assurance group
37 Tracker maintaining group
38 Documentation group
39 Other which leaders think would be good
40
41 h2. Election process
42
43 Voting is done by all those who are registered at development tracker at dev.xonotic.org Those supposedly are community members who help game development and have clues how inner game development is going on. Leaders are elected for 2 year terms and can be reelected again after their service time finished. If somebody leaves the board during the service time, new elections are made and elected person serves the remaining time until new elections.
44 Votes are counted using Borda Count method: http://en.wikipedia.org/wiki/Borda_count
45
46 For example, in an election for a leader position with 6 candidates, the rankings are scored as follows: 
47 rank  points
48  1______6 
49  2______5 
50  3______4 
51  4______3 
52  5______2 
53  6______1 
54  none___0 
55 Thus, refusing to rank someone denies them any points at all. Of course each rank can be assigned to at most one candidate.
56 Candidate with the highest point total is elected to the board to fill the position he was elected for.